GCC Regulatory Framework

NHRA + research peptides — Bahrain's pharmaceutical-import framework

The National Health Regulatory Authority (NHRA) of Bahrain regulates pharmaceuticals, medical devices, and healthcare professionals under Law No. 38 of 2009 (Establishing the National Health Regulatory Authority) and the Pharmacy Practice Law. NHRA registers and inspects pharmaceutical products entering Bahrain. Research peptides without NHRA registration are treated as unregistered medicines. This article documents the NHRA framework, the practical implications for Bahrain-based researchers, and the GCC-regional context that determines operational reality.

NHRA was established by Law No. 38 of 2009 as Bahrain's independent health regulator, consolidating pharmaceutical and medical-device oversight under one body. NHRA registers pharmaceutical products, licenses pharmacies and pharmacists, regulates pharmacovigilance, and inspects imports. Compounds without NHRA registration fall under the unregistered-medicine framework — research peptides included.

On WADA / sport-doping side, Bahrain athletes are tested under the Bahrain Anti-Doping Committee, a WADA signatory. Sanctions follow the standard WADA Code framework — 4-year ban for intentional S2 violations. Bahrain's elite-sport visibility is lower than UAE or Saudi Arabia but has grown with the Bahrain Grand Prix and other international events; anti-doping testing visibility has expanded correspondingly.
